Aeronautical / Aerospace Engineering is one of the most challenging fields of engineering with a wide scope for growth. This field deals with the development of new technology in the field of aviation, space exploration and defence systems. It specialises in the designing, construction, development, testing, operation and maintenance of both commercial and military aircraft, spacecrafts and their components as well as satellites and missiles

Hotel management is running a hotel and hospitality is the term used for an industry based on hospitality(dealing with people) - Hotel, restaurant, pub, night clubs, travel agents etc.So hotel management is part of the hospitality industry.
Hospitality is an integral part of hotel industry. Hospitality has also been a part of services industry. More or less hospitality is associated with each and every industry.

Architectural degree is designed in such a way so that it fulfills the educational component of professional certifying bodies. This field covers different works such as spatial design, safety management, aesthetics, material management, etc. Average fees for this course in government colleges ranges from INR 1.5 to 2.5 Lacs and in private institutes, it ranges from approximately. INR 2.5 to 5 Lacs. After the successful completion of this course, the students can pursue their career in architecture sector with the average salary range between INR 2.5 to 4.5 LPA.
